Types of Bidet Systems You Can Choose

Bidet systems come in multiple configurations, each varying in design, features, installation complexity, and cost. All share the same core function of water-based cleansing but differ significantly in technological sophistication.

Standalone Bidets: Separate Fixtures

A standalone bidet is a porcelain fixture installed next to the toilet, resembling a small washbasin. Users straddle the bowl facing the faucet and direct water manually. These are common in Europe, especially Italy and France, where they have been part of bathroom design for over a century. While highly effective, they require dedicated floor space and additional plumbing, making them impractical for smaller bathrooms. Drying is typically done with a separate towel.

Handheld Bidet Sprayers: Manual Control

Also known as a shattaf, bum gun, or health faucet, this portable device attaches to the toilet tank or wall with a flexible hose and spray nozzle. Activated by hand, it gives users complete control over spray direction and pressure. Popular in Islamic cultures for religious purification, it is also widely used across Asia and the Middle East. Most models use cold water, though some connect to hot lines. It is inexpensive, easy to install, and doubles as a tool for cleaning the toilet bowl or diapers.

Non-Electric Bidet Attachments

These budget-friendly devices replace your toilet seat and connect directly to the water supply via a T-valve. No electricity is needed. A side-mounted knob controls the spray, allowing adjustments in pressure and sometimes temperature. Ideal for renters or those without nearby outlets, these attachments cost under $100 and install in minutes. While they lack advanced features like heated seats or dryers, they offer a simple, effective upgrade from toilet paper.

Smart Bidet Toilet Seats

The most popular type in North America, electric bidet seats replace your existing toilet seat with a high-tech unit. These require a GFCI-protected electrical outlet within six feet and offer features such as heated seat, adjustable water temperature and pressure, oscillating or pulsating spray, warm air dryer, deodorizer, and remote control. They attach to your current toilet, making installation DIY-friendly. Brands like TOTO and Bio Bidet dominate this space, offering customizable settings and memory presets for multiple users.

All-in-One Bidet Toilets

These integrated units combine the toilet and bidet into one sleek fixture. Often called Washlets (TOTO) or Sanitarinas (INAX), they come with full automation including automatic lid opening, sensor-activated flushing, self-cleaning nozzles, and app connectivity. Found in luxury homes and high-end hotels, they offer the ultimate in convenience and design. However, they are expensive and usually require professional installation. They are standard in Japan and South Korea, where bidet adoption exceeds 70 percent.

Portable Travel Bidets

For on-the-go hygiene, travel bidets come in squeeze-bottle or battery-powered electric forms. Fill with clean water, aim, and spray while seated on any toilet. No installation, no plumbing, just portability. Great for camping, flights, or public restrooms, they help maintain hygiene routines anywhere. Limitations include no heated water or drying function, but they ensure cleanliness when facilities are subpar.

Step-by-Step: How a Smart Bidet Operates

The operation of an electric bidet toilet seat involves a coordinated sequence of mechanical, hydraulic, and electronic processes working together seamlessly.

User Activation and Detection

After using the toilet, you stay seated. To begin, press a button on the side panel or remote control. High-end models use weight or proximity sensors to detect your presence and activate automatically. This prevents accidental spraying and enables hands-free use, especially helpful for seniors or those with limited mobility.

Nozzle Deployment and Positioning

Once activated, a retractable stainless steel nozzle extends from beneath the seat. Most units have two nozzles. The rear nozzle cleans the anus and inner buttocks. The front nozzle is shorter and angled forward for feminine hygiene. The nozzle moves into position just below you, ready to deliver a precise water stream. Some models allow adjustable nozzle position for personalized comfort.

Water Delivery and Spray Options

Fresh water is drawn from your home is cold water line through a T-valve connected to the toilet is supply. Electric models heat the water instantly or from a small internal tank. You can customize water temperature from cool to warm, pressure from light mist to strong jet, and spray mode including standard, oscillating, pulsating, or enema. An oscillating wash moves the nozzle side-to-side for broader coverage, while a pulsating mode offers a massaging effect.

Self-Cleaning and Retraction

After use, the nozzle automatically retracts into its housing. Before and after each use, it runs a self-cleaning cycle, rinsing with water and sometimes using UV light, silver-ion coating, or electrolyzed water to disinfect. This ensures hygiene and prevents bacterial buildup. The nozzle remains sealed when not in use.

Warm Air Drying

On electric models, a ceramic heating element and quiet fan blow warm air through a vent under the seat. Drying takes one to three minutes, depending on humidity and settings. With this feature, many users eliminate toilet paper entirely. Multiple heat levels let you choose between a gentle breeze or fast dry.

Odor Removal System

As you sit, an intake fan pulls air from the toilet bowl through an activated carbon filter. This neutralizes odors caused by hydrogen sulfide and ammonia, far more effective than masking with sprays. The deodorizer turns off automatically when you stand up.

Control Interface and Memory Settings

All functions are managed by an internal microprocessor. You interact via a side panel that is always attached and requires no batteries, a wireless remote that is wall-mounted and easy to use, or memory presets that save preferences for multiple users. Families can store different profiles for water temp, pressure, seat heat, and dryer settings, making shared bathrooms more convenient.

Water Supply and Plumbing Setup

Understanding the plumbing integration helps you install and maintain your bidet properly.

T-Valve Connection to Toilet Line

Bidet toilets connect to your existing water supply using a T-valve adapter. This small device splits the flow, with one stream going to the toilet tank for flushing and one going to the bidet system. The T-valve installs easily on the toilet is inlet pipe behind the bowl. It ensures fresh, potable water is used, never recycled or gray water. No major plumbing changes are needed for most models.

Cold vs. Heated Water Systems

Most non-electric bidets use cold water only. Electric models add on-demand heating through either a tankless instant heater that heats water as it flows or a tank-style heater that stores warm water. Higher-end units blend hot and cold water for precise temperature control. A micro-thermostat adjusts in real time to prevent scalding.

Installation Requirements

To install a bidet seat, turn off the water supply, remove the old toilet seat, install the T-valve on the water inlet, connect the bidet hose to the T-valve, mount the seat and tighten the bolts, plug into a GFCI outlet for electric models, and test for leaks and function. Most installations take under 30 minutes with basic tools. If no outlet is nearby, hiring an electrician adds $100 to $300.

Safety and Hygiene Features

Modern bidet toilets include multiple safety mechanisms to ensure clean and safe operation.

Nozzle Sanitization Methods

Bidet nozzles are designed for maximum hygiene through self-rinsing before and after each use, stainless steel or antimicrobial plastic construction, and UV-C light or silver-ion coating in premium models. These features prevent cross-contamination and keep the system clean without manual intervention.

Electrical and Leak Protection

Electric bidet seats are fully sealed and waterproof. Safety systems include GFCI outlet requirement that cuts power if moisture is detected, thermal cut-offs to prevent overheating, and overflow sensors with emergency shut-offs. These protections make modern bidets safe for home use even in humid environments.

Seat Sensors and Hands-Free Use

Weight-activated sensors ensure the bidet only operates when someone is seated. This prevents accidental activation and supports hands-free operation, a key benefit for elderly or disabled users.

Health and Skin Benefits

Switching to a bidet offers significant advantages for your health and skin.

Reduced Risk of Infections

Water cleansing removes fecal residue more effectively than wiping, lowering the risk of urinary tract infections, yeast infections, hemorrhoids, and anal fissures. It is especially recommended post-surgery, after childbirth, or for those with inflammatory bowel disease.

Gentle on Sensitive Skin

Unlike abrasive toilet paper, water does not cause micro-tears or inflammation. Ideal for people with eczema, psoriasis, diabetes-related skin fragility, or arthritis. The result is less itching, redness, and discomfort.

Improved Accessibility

Bidets reduce the need to twist or reach, making hygiene easier for seniors, post-surgical patients, people with back pain or spinal injuries, and caregivers assisting others. Handheld sprayers are particularly useful for bedridden or wheelchair users.

Environmental and Cost Advantages

Bidets offer compelling benefits for both your wallet and the planet.

Toilet Paper Reduction and Tree Conservation

Switching to a bidet can eliminate or drastically reduce toilet paper use. If the U.S. adopted bidets widely, it could save 15 million trees annually. Even partial use cuts household paper consumption by 75 percent or more.

Water and Carbon Footprint Savings

A bidet uses just 0.5 liters per use. In contrast, producing one roll of toilet paper requires 140 liters of water. Bidets also reduce carbon emissions from manufacturing and transport and prevent sewer blockages caused by flushable wipes.

Long-Term Cost Savings

The average U.S. household spends $100 to $250 per year on toilet paper. A $50 bidet attachment pays for itself in 2 to 3 months. Even a $500 smart seat pays back in 1 to 3 years.

Global Use and Cultural Adoption

Bidets have varying levels of adoption around the world, shaped by history and culture.

High-Adoption Countries

Japan has approximately 76 percent household use since TOTO launched the first Washlet in 1980. South Korea has nearly universal adoption in homes. Italy, France, and Spain commonly include bidets in new builds. The Middle East and North Africa require water cleansing religiously in Islam. Thailand and Malaysia use handheld sprayers or scooper basins as standard.

Low-Adoption Regions and Changing Trends

North America, the UK, and Australia have historically low usage due to cultural unfamiliarity. But adoption is rising fast, driven by toilet paper shortages during the pandemic, environmental awareness, celebrity endorsements, and increased product availability.

Historical Origins

The word bidet comes from French, meaning pony, referencing the straddling motion. First used in 1710 in France, early models were in bedrooms. Japan revolutionized the concept in 1980 with the electronic Washlet, adding heat, spray control, and drying.

Maintenance and Troubleshooting

Keeping your bidet working properly requires simple regular care.

Weekly Cleaning Routine

Wipe down the seat, controls, and housing with a mild bathroom cleaner. Avoid bleach or ammonia, which can damage plastics and electronics. Use a soft cloth to prevent scratches.

Monthly Filter and Nozzle Care

Clean the water inlet filter at the T-valve monthly by removing it, rinsing it under tap water, and reinstalling. Descale the nozzle with white vinegar in hard water areas to prevent clogs.

Annual System Checks

Inspect hoses for cracks or leaks, replace worn gaskets, and change deodorizer filters as recommended. Check electrical connections if using a GFCI outlet.

Common Issues and Fixes

Leaking at the T-valve requires tightening connections or replacing the rubber washer. Low water pressure means cleaning the inlet filter or upgrading to a pump-boost model. No water flow requires checking the shut-off valve and hose for kinks. Strange odors call for running the self-cleaning cycle and wiping under the seat with vinegar. Electrical errors require resetting the unit and ensuring the GFCI outlet is working.

Choosing the Right Bidet for Your Needs

Select a bidet based on your specific situation and requirements.

Renters and Budget Users

Go for a handheld sprayer priced at $20 to $50 or a non-electric attachment. These are affordable, easy to install, and removable, perfect for temporary spaces.

Homeowners Wanting Comfort

An electric bidet seat priced at $200 to $800 offers heated seating, warm water, air drying, and remote control. It transforms your bathroom into a spa-like experience.

Seniors and Disabled Users

Choose a smart seat with remote control and memory settings. Hands-free activation, adjustable settings, and warm air drying promote independence.

Caregivers and Medical Needs

A handheld sprayer provides maximum flexibility for assisting others. It is easy to aim and can be used for wound care or post-surgical hygiene.

Travelers

Pack a portable travel bidet that is lightweight, requires no setup, and maintains your hygiene routine anywhere.

Frequently Asked Questions About Bidet Toilets

Does a bidet toilet use the same water as the toilet?

No. Bidet toilets connect directly to your fresh water supply line, not the toilet bowl. The T-valve adapter draws clean, potable water from the same line that supplies your toilet tank, ensuring hygienic water for cleansing.

Can I install a bidet seat myself?

Yes. Most electric bidet seats install in 20 to 45 minutes using basic tools. You need to turn off the water, remove the old seat, install the T-valve, connect the hose, mount the seat, and plug it into a GFCI outlet. Non-electric attachments install even faster.

Do bidets require electricity?

Only advanced models require electricity. Handheld sprayers and non-electric attachments operate purely on water pressure. Electric bidet seats need a GFCI-protected outlet within six feet of the toilet for features like heated seats, warm water, and air drying.

Are bidets safe for sensitive skin?

Yes. Bidets are gentler than toilet paper because water does not cause abrasion, micro-tears, or inflammation. They are particularly beneficial for people with eczema, psoriasis, hemorrhoids, or post-surgical recovery.

How much water does a bidet use per use?

A bidet uses approximately 0.5 liters (one-eighth of a gallon) per use. This is significantly less water than is required to produce one roll of toilet paper, which needs about 140 liters.
